Survey of Heritage Language Teaching at UCLA
Appendix 2 -- Table 2: Heritage speakers in UCLA Language Courses, Fall 1999
Approximate numbers in all courses, in numerical order
Language |
Approximate number of Heritage speakers across all language department courses |
| Spanish | 30 in specific courses for HL but a large, unidentified number in other advanced courses |
| Chinese | 200-250 |
| Korean | 200-250 |
| Russian | 81 |
| Vietnamese | 57 |
| Tagalog | 34 |
| Egyptian Colloquial Arabic | 25 |
| Hindi | 25 |
| Persian | 24 |
| Hebrew | 17 |
| Japanese | 15 |
| Polish | 11 |
| Thai | 10-12 |
| Ukrainian | 2 |
| Indonesian | 1-3 |
This survey project, conducted Fall 1999, was produced under the auspices of the Language Resource Center, by Helen Reid, in collaboration with Olga Kagan, Chairperson of the Foreign Language Resource Committee.
